看板 Cad_Cae 關於我們 聯絡資訊
JY 大大的 第三個程式 改寫的希望是 希望能夠按照 點的物件,被選取的順序, 順向,或是 反向輸出。 這點,比較麻煩。 考慮的方向有, 一 如果點很多的話, 一個 一個選取的可能性如何? 二 AutoCAD 是否會 乖乖的,按照點的物件 被選取的順序,順向或是 反向的排序? 這點需要 驗證一下。 三 我比較 prefer 的是, 輸出以後,寫一個 C的程式去排序, 按照 X座標,或是 Y座標, 或是,轉換成 極座標, 按照 R, 或是 theta 排序。 或是,當初產生 點的物件的時候, 把 序號,或是其他 參考資料, 以 屬性的方式,加入點的物件當中, 然後 一起輸出。 然後,就可以按照 序號來排序。 ※ 引述《jyhchyunlu (jyhchyunlu)》之銘言: : 這幾天為了做一份報告 : 需要把AUTOCAD上點的座標值匯出成TXT檔 : 於是開始上板上爬文 : 結果找了一篇2007年 sjgau板友發表的文章 : 用AUTOLISP擷取座標直 : 原本就對AUTOCAD不熟的我 : 第一次聽到AUTOLISP覺得很新奇 : 也覺得這種東西很厲害 : 可以依照自己的需求去寫程式 : 完成AUTOCAD自身很難完成的事情 : 於是在此推薦新手 : 如果在AUTOCAD上有特殊需求 : 可以朝著AUTOLISP這方面去解決問題 : 熟練的話 : 這會是一個很強大的功能 : 在此也謝謝sjgau板友 : 不但提供程式 : 還幫我修改成完整符合我所需的功能 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.20.153.219